Output 3b3f61e625f26d3fb2a010329a295b301ea0a3961ea7f97f718100fc72528097:52

value
410000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c61ebc60c7361ff48deda9432a66e59942b99e1c OP_EQUAL
address
3KkaY6D1UgiA2WY1sid5GfSNiWBgA7N2xh
transaction
3b3f61e625f26d3fb2a010329a295b301ea0a3961ea7f97f718100fc72528097
confirmations
245894
spent
true